How they compare
Israel currently reports 1.07 tonnes per person against 1.07 tonnes per person in Bhutan, a difference of 0 tonnes per person.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 55 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Israel ahead.
Bhutan ranks 40th and Israel ranks 39th of 179 countries.
Israel has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bhutan | Israel |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 0.0009 tonnes per person | 0.0048 tonnes per person | 0.0039 tonnes per person | Israel |
| 1980s | 0.0197 tonnes per person | 1.36 tonnes per person | 1.34 tonnes per person | Israel |
| 1990s | 0.1761 tonnes per person | 3.27 tonnes per person | 3.1 tonnes per person | Israel |
| 2000s | 0.3314 tonnes per person | 4.4 tonnes per person | 4.07 tonnes per person | Israel |
| 2010s | 0.7405 tonnes per person | 3.08 tonnes per person | 2.34 tonnes per person | Israel |
| 2020s | 0.9296 tonnes per person | 1.49 tonnes per person | 0.5619 tonnes per person | Israel |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
